Non-Owner SR-22 Insurance in Harrisburg, PA

Non-owner SR-22 policies in Harrisburg typically cost $35–$65/month, roughly 40% less than owner SR-22. Pennsylvania requires 3-year filing for most suspension causes, and non-owner coverage satisfies DMV reinstatement requirements without an owned vehicle.

What Affects Rates in Harrisburg

  • Harrisburg's CAT bus system and walkable downtown reduce vehicle dependency during filing periods. Non-owner SR-22 provides liability coverage when borrowing cars for occasional trips outside the city or to suburban job sites in Susquehanna Township or Lower Paxton.
  • Progressive, The General, and regional non-standard carriers operate in Dauphin County and write non-owner SR-22 policies. Harrisburg's proximity to carrier service centers in Camp Hill and Hershey shortens processing times compared to rural Pennsylvania markets.
  • Dense traffic on State Street and I-83 interchange congestion elevate liability exposure for occasional drivers. Non-owner policies carry Pennsylvania's 15/30/5 minimum liability limits, but urban readers should consider 50/100/25 or higher when driving borrowed vehicles in metro areas.
  • Dauphin County's 3 heavy snow events and 2 winter storm events in the last 5 years create elevated risk for occasional drivers unfamiliar with borrowed vehicles. Non-owner SR-22 covers liability when you drive someone else's car, but comprehensive and collision coverage stays with the vehicle owner's policy.
